At 40 days your Regain results should be STARTING. Don't stop until you have tried it for at least 120 days. You can expect results at the 2nd month mark, some see results slightly after that. You will know by the 3-4 month mark if it is working for you, though most see results at the 2-3 month mark.

Your hair should improve. Especially with the addition of finasteride.


Get a shampoo with Ketoconazole 2% and then you have a nice regimen against hairloss. Good luck.

Remember: Lasers are scams. Only the 3(minoxidil, finasteride, ketoconazole 2%) treatments I mentioned really work. Do not spend money on anything else.

It's definitely worth using both treatments. They're the two best products/drugs a man can use to save his hair.

A single daily application of Regaine is worthwhile, but twice per day will increase the potential for it to be of maximum effectiveness.

You got good advice already about the length of time needed to judge your response to Regaine. With Fin it's usually recommended to wait a full year before deciding whether it was worthwhile. Keep that in mind.
